Output 95af649875782a3c07fb4d056f2f121ace5a53da0d7f7ef7dff4ed1fd4a040ed:4

value
13565342
script pubkey
OP_0 OP_PUSHBYTES_20 6cc652916ee3de5ba820c3539c0cc5af55c33ca5
address
bc1qdnr99ytwu009h2pqcdfecrx94a2ux0993eq0se
transaction
95af649875782a3c07fb4d056f2f121ace5a53da0d7f7ef7dff4ed1fd4a040ed
spent
true